[0001] This utility model relates to a hoisting device, and more particularly to a demolding hoisting device for the production of tunnel segments. Background Technology
[0002] Tunnel boring machine (TBM) segments are the main assembly components in TBM construction, and their quality directly affects the overall quality and safety of the tunnel. During production, TBM segments are fabricated in molds. After fabrication, they are removed and transported using hoisting equipment. Currently, most manufacturers use vacuum suction cups as hoisting equipment. During removal, the vacuum suction cup is placed against the outer surface of the TBM segment in the mold. A vacuum pump is activated, creating a vacuum in the vacuum accumulator. When suction is needed, the vacuum accumulator is connected to the inner cavity of the vacuum suction cup, creating a pressure difference between the inner cavity and the external atmospheric pressure, thus lifting the TBM segment. However, practical use has revealed that relying solely on vacuum suction cups for lifting lacks adequate safety measures. For example, in the event of a sudden power outage or equipment malfunction, the vacuum suction cup may lose its suction capacity, causing the TBM segment to detach, posing a significant safety hazard. [0003] The purpose of this utility model is to provide a demolding and hoisting device for the production of tunnel segments, which adds a protective claw hook to the vacuum suction cup, and plays a good protective role in the process of hoisting and transporting tunnel segments.
[0004] To achieve the above objectives, the present invention adopts the following technical solution:
[0005] A demolding and hoisting device for tunnel segment production includes a hoisting platform. Vacuum suction cups and protective claw hooks are rotatably mounted below the hoisting platform. The vacuum suction cups include a central suction cup located in the middle of the hoisting platform and side suction cups located on either side of the central suction cup. The protective claw hooks include a central claw hook located outside both ends of the central suction cup and a side claw hook located outside both ends of the side suction cups. The central claw hook and the side claw hooks are rotated outwards and lifted by a cylinder-driven mechanism, and then locked by the cylinder-driven mechanism after returning to a vertical state under their own gravity.

[0013] like Figures 1 to 5 As shown, this utility model proposes a demolding and hoisting device for shield tunnel segment production, which includes a hoisting platform 10. Vacuum suction cups and protective claw hooks are rotatably installed below the hoisting platform 10. The vacuum suction cups include a central suction cup 21 located in the middle of the hoisting platform 10 and side suction cups 22 located on both sides of the central suction cup 21. The protective claw hooks include a central claw hook 31 located outside both ends of the central suction cup 21 and a side claw hook 32 located outside both ends of the side suction cups 22. The central claw hook 31 and the side claw hook 32 are rotated outward and lifted by a cylinder drive mechanism. After returning to a vertical state under their own gravity, they are locked by the cylinder drive mechanism.
[0014] In actual use, the hoisting platform 10 can be slidably installed on the hoisting beam via connectors to achieve hoisting.
[0015] like Figure 1 The hoisting platform 10 includes two parallel central longitudinal beams 11, and a side longitudinal beam 12 is provided on each side of the two central longitudinal beams 11. The central longitudinal beams 11 and the side longitudinal beams 12 are connected by two parallel cross beams 13, which are perpendicular to the central longitudinal beams 11 and the side longitudinal beams 12.
[0016] In actual design, the structure of the hoisting platform 10 is not subject to the above restrictions, and the configuration of the central longitudinal beam 11, side longitudinal beams 12, and cross beams 13 can vary widely, not limited to those shown in the figure, as long as it provides installation and operating space for the protective claw hooks and vacuum suction cups. For example, as... Figure 5 The longitudinal beam 11 and side longitudinal beam 12 shown in the figure include L-shaped profiles. Protective claw hooks are pinned to the L-shaped profiles. A top plate is welded to the top surface of the L-shaped profiles, and reinforcing sealing plates are welded to both ends of the L-shaped profiles. The reinforcing sealing plates have elongated through holes for the protective claw hooks to pass through. Additionally, the L-shaped profiles have holes for the crossbeam 13 to pass through. Furthermore, Figure 5The crossbeam 13 shown is a hollow square steel tube, with the two ends of the tube sealed with sealing plates.
[0017] like Figures 1 to 5 The side suction cup 22 is connected to the crossbeam 13 via the first rotating component 40. The first rotating component 40 includes a first suction cup connecting plate 41. Each crossbeam 13 is connected to a first suction cup connecting plate 41. A first connecting shaft 43 is installed on both first suction cup connecting plates 41. A first mounting plate 42 is rotatably installed on the first connecting shaft 43. The first mounting plate 42 is fixed to the side suction cup 22. The side suction cup 22 can rotate around the first connecting shaft 43 by means of the first mounting plate 42 to closely adhere to the surfaces of the shield tunnel segments with different inclinations and improve the suction force. Figure 1 The illustration shows a case where a first mounting plate 42 is installed at each end of the first connecting shaft 43.
[0018] Furthermore, the central suction cup 21 is connected to the crossbeam 13 via a second rotating component 70. The second rotating component 70 includes a second suction cup connecting plate 71, with each crossbeam 13 connected to a second suction cup connecting plate 71. A second connecting shaft 73 is mounted on both second suction cup connecting plates 71. A second mounting plate 72 is rotatably mounted on the second connecting shaft 73. The second mounting plate 72 is fixed to the central suction cup 21, allowing the central suction cup 21 to rotate around the second connecting shaft 73 via the second mounting plate 72, thus adhering closely to the surfaces of the tunnel segments at different inclinations and enhancing the suction force. Similar to the side suction cups 22, a second mounting plate 72 is typically mounted at each end of the second connecting shaft 73.
[0019] A preferred design is that the second suction cup connecting plate 71 of the second rotating component 70 has protruding abutment tops 710 on both sides of its top, making the second suction cup connecting plate 71 T-shaped. Two top bars 79 are separately provided on the crossbeam 13, and sealing plates 76 are provided on the outer sides of the two top bars 79. A vertically penetrating sliding space is formed between the sealing plates 76, the two top bars 79, and the crossbeam 13, allowing the second suction cup connecting plate 71 to slide vertically through the sliding space. Positioning nuts 74 are fixed to the abutment tops 710 extending upwards from the second suction cup connecting plate 71 into the sliding space. Adjusting bolts 75 are movably screwed onto the positioning nuts 74. The portion of the adjusting bolt 75 extending downwards from the abutment top 710 abuts against the corresponding top bar 79. By adjusting the tightness of the adjusting bolts 75 screwed onto the positioning nuts 74, the lifting height of the abutment top 710 on the top bar 79 is changed, thus adjusting the height of the second suction cup connecting plate 71, thereby adjusting the height of the central suction cup 21. The second suction cup connecting plate 71 is provided with a positioning hole (not shown in the figure), and the sealing plate 76 is provided with a hole. A locking nut 78 is fixed in the hole, and a locking bolt 77 is movably screwed onto the locking nut 78. The locking bolt 77 is used to extend into the corresponding positioning hole on the second suction cup connecting plate 71 through the hole on the sealing plate 76 after the height of the second suction cup connecting plate 71 is adjusted by adjusting the degree of screwing with the locking nut 78, so as to lock the height of the second suction cup connecting plate 71.
[0020] In the actual design, the second suction cup connecting plate 71 can be provided with multiple positioning holes in the vertical direction, and the sealing plate 76 can be provided with at least one hole as appropriate. Each hole is fixed with a locking nut 78 and movably screwed with a locking bolt 77.
[0021] In this invention, the height of the central suction cup 21 is adjustable, enabling the invention to meet the adsorption and lifting requirements of shield tunnel segments with different curvatures.
[0022] In actual control, the central suction cup 21 and the side suction cup 22 are synchronously controlled by an adsorption control device, which includes a vacuum pump and a vacuum accumulator.
[0023] In this invention, the adsorption control device is an existing device in the field. Typically, the adsorption control device includes a vacuum pump, which is connected to a vacuum accumulator via an air pipe. The vacuum accumulator is connected to the inner cavities of the central suction cup 21 and the side suction cup 22 via a vent pipe, and a solenoid valve is installed on the vent pipe. In use, the central suction cup 21 and the side suction cup 22 are pressed tightly against the outer surface of the shield tunnel segment. Then, the vacuum pump is started to evacuate the vacuum accumulator. When adsorption is needed, the solenoid valve is opened, connecting the vacuum accumulator with the inner cavities of the central suction cup 21 and the side suction cup 22. This creates a pressure difference between the air pressure inside the central suction cup 21 and the side suction cup 22 and the external atmosphere, thus allowing the central suction cup 21 and the side suction cup 22 to adsorb the shield tunnel segment and lift it.

[0026] In actual control, each first cylinder 51 and each second cylinder 61 are synchronously driven by the pneumatic control device. Specifically, the first cylinder 51 and the second cylinder 61 are locking cylinders. These cylinders are used to lift the central claw hook 31 and the side claw hook 32 outwards by pushing them with their piston rods. Once lifted to the correct position, the pneumatic control device disengages the drive to the locking cylinders, allowing the central claw hook 31 and the side claw hook 32 to return to their original vertical position under their own weight. At this point, the locking cylinders engage a locking action, locking the positions of the central claw hook 31 and the side claw hook 32. This reduces the cylinders' prolonged exposure to load, lowers the failure rate, and extends their service life.
[0027] In this invention, the pneumatic control device and locking cylinder are well-known in the art, and therefore will not be described in detail here. The first cylinder 51 and the second cylinder 61 are miniature cylinders, which will not increase the overall weight.
[0028] In this invention, the protective claw hook adopts the above-mentioned pneumatic drive and reset self-locking mechanism, which effectively ensures the stable support of the tunnel segment without the need for manual intervention, thereby improving production efficiency.

[0031] When the tunnel segment 90 is completed in the tunnel segment mold and needs to be removed and hoisted, the first cylinder 51 and the second cylinder 61 are driven by the pneumatic control device, causing their piston rods to press against the central claw hook 31 and the side claw hook 32, causing the central claw hook 31 and the side claw hook 32 to rotate outward and lift. At this time, the entire protective claw hook is in an open state, as... Figure 4 As shown. Then, the central suction cup 21 and the side suction cup 22 are made to adhere tightly to the outer surface of the shield segment 90. The vacuum pump is started, and the vacuum pump evacuates the vacuum accumulator. Then, the solenoid valve is opened, connecting the vacuum accumulator with the inner cavity of the central suction cup 21 and the side suction cup 22, so that the central suction cup 21 and the side suction cup 22 adsorb the shield segment 90, thus lifting the shield segment 90. Then, the pneumatic control device is deactivated, and the central claw hook 31 and the side claw hook 32 return to their original vertical state under their own gravity (as shown). Figure 2 and Figure 5 At this time, the first cylinder 51 and the second cylinder 61 lock themselves, locking the positions of the middle claw hook 31 and the side claw hook 32. At this time, there is a gap between the hooks of the middle claw hook 31 and the side claw hook 32 and the shield tunnel segment 90. Figure 5 Therefore, the tunnel segment 90 can be transported.
[0032] During hoisting, if a sudden power outage or equipment malfunction occurs in the workshop, the vacuum suction cup may lose its suction capacity, causing the tunnel segment to fall. However, due to the design of the protective claw hooks, such as... Figure 5 As shown, the falling tunnel segment 90 will be firmly held in place by the central claw hook 31 and the side claw hook 32. It can be seen that the protective claw hooks play a good protective role and ensure production safety.
